    SUMMARY OF DUTIES:

    The Digital Content Specialist will maintain and develop the FeedMore WNY and Hearty Helpings Inc. external websites and intranet. The position provides social media support for the department and organization and writes the copy for the staff and volunteer newsletters.

    R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Responsible for maintaining organization's websites, including adding and updating pages, copy, images and graphics;
    • Proactively perform regular website audits to ensure content is accurate, up-to-date and aligned with organizational mission and brand as well as current organizational priorities;
    • Work with senior management and other departments to source and create content for website that supports organization's goals, including but not limited to blog posts, calendar listings and page updates;
    • Develop and implement strategies to improve search optimization efforts, user experience and increase website traffic;
    • Improve website look and functionality and maintain an industry-leading position;
    • Respond to, troubleshoot and solve website issues;
    • Work with external vendor and IT and Systems Director on major website projects and website maintenance;
    • Ensure website complies with appropriate laws and regulations;
    • Maintain organization's Google Business presence with regular monitoring and updates as needed;
    • Manage an organizational intranet to strengthen internal communications, including adding and updating pages, copy, images and graphics;
    • Create copy deck and work with Graphic Designer to produce monthly newsletter for staff and Board of Directors and quarterly newsletter for volunteers.
    • Assist in the creation and publishing of high-quality content for organization's social media platforms;
    • Provide support to other Communications Team members as needed;
    • Assist with any and all mission work as needed and requested with some or no prior notice including, but not limited to: serving as a truck spotter, helping with Farm Market/Community Garden/Freight Farms/on and off-site food distributions, preparation of meals and serving home-delivered meals; and
    • Other duties as assigned.

    Requirements

    • Bachelor's degree preferred (or equivalent experience) plus proven experience of 2-3 years in communications, digital content creation or related field;
    • Web development skills, preferably experience working in WordPress;
    • Experience with Microsoft SharePoint, Word, PowerPoint and Excel;
    • Knowledge of various social media platforms and best practices;
    • Excellent oral, written and interpersonal skills; requires a team player attitude; attention to detail, project coordination, leadership abilities; efficiency and passion for the mission;
    • The ideal candidate is well organized and able to optimize the use of space and equipment while reducing costs;
    • Comfortable juggling multiple projects simultaneously and working under a variety of deadlines;
    • Ability to collaborate with staff at all levels, ability to work with individuals of all educational levels, varied backgrounds and skills sets, including department personnel; as well as interface with board, CAC and committee members, community members, volunteers and vendors;
    • Knowledge of Adobe Creative Suite a plus;
    • Intrinsically motivated with the ability to work independently or with a team;
    • Valid NYS Driver's License and daily access to a vehicle; and
    • Capable of lifting 35 lbs.
